Job DescriptionAECOM is hiring an Entry‑Level Biologist in our Florida office locations (Coral Gables, Fort Lauderdale, Orlando, Tampa, Jacksonville, Tallahassee). The successful candidate will work within an interdisciplinary, collaborative environment that supports career growth within AECOM’s Environmental Planning & Permitting (EPP) Southeast Team. This position involves both in‑person and virtual work, performing environmental impact assessments, marine and terrestrial wetland delineations, protected species surveys, stormwater inspections, permitting, and technical report writing.
Responsibilities- Assist the lead Biologist/Scientist in performing wetland, plant, wildlife, protected upland, intertidal and nearshore marine surveys.
- Process field data and develop ecological assessment reports using tablets, GPS units, and other equipment.
- Coordinate with governmental agencies regarding survey protocols, reporting standards, endangered species and NEPA compliance.
- Identify potential environmental impacts through plan reviews, aerial observations, field data, desktop research, and GIS databases.
- Conduct visual inspections of drainage facilities.
- Familiarize with field survey equipment, data forms, and reporting tools.
- Assist in preparing permit applications, NEPA documents, and other technical information.
